Yao-Bin Liu is a scholar working on Molecular Biology, Materials Chemistry and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, Yao-Bin Liu has authored 33 papers receiving a total of 890 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 6 papers in Materials Chemistry and 5 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Yao-Bin Liu’s work include Quantum and electron transport phenomena (5 papers), Graphene research and applications (4 papers) and Immune Cell Function and Interaction (3 papers). Yao-Bin Liu is often cited by papers focused on Quantum and electron transport phenomena (5 papers), Graphene research and applications (4 papers) and Immune Cell Function and Interaction (3 papers). Yao-Bin Liu collaborates with scholars based in China, Canada and France. Yao-Bin Liu's co-authors include Yunhua Wang, Biao Wang, Ming Hung Wong, Hong‐Hong Yan, Cheng Huang, Ying Cheng, Shengxiang Ren, Shun Lü, Yi−Long Wu and Jin‐Ji Yang and has published in prestigious journals such as Applied Physics Letters, Neuroscience and British Journal of Cancer.
